Output 57bd2f81cd5e94b5e061f140c80ef246f91898f1a7ef440d240deb0f2045a82e:1

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53649cd80fbe3b5650e651869579ef0142a9a1f9 OP_EQUAL
address
39HxYA3JRQLCKiJwxd6jS9fAEkVAHZsA1V
transaction
57bd2f81cd5e94b5e061f140c80ef246f91898f1a7ef440d240deb0f2045a82e
spent
true